Output 89a5a974062d50a043f50af0ca53b21081de53b57d902a7344fddbadbf635127:5

value
45990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 888866eb0d73d0fd557b1b4110113e0e58ab217b OP_EQUAL
address
MLM5Xu2pk75rbdtcxKebJX8ccCiHYUM7J8
transaction
89a5a974062d50a043f50af0ca53b21081de53b57d902a7344fddbadbf635127
spent
true